Wise Cars Online Car Hire Portal Development

Introduction

The Wise Cars project, undertaken by V1 Technologies, exemplifies our commitment to delivering innovative and effective web solutions tailored to client needs. This case study delves into the comprehensive process behind the development of Wise Cars, a London-based small car and van self-drive hire business. The narrative covers every aspect of the project, from the initial ideation and requirements gathering to the design, development, testing, deployment, and post-launch support. Our journey showcases the unique challenges faced, the methodologies employed, and the successful outcomes achieved.

Initial Ideation and Requirements Gathering

Client Interaction

The project began with a series of consultations with the client to understand their business model, target audience, and specific requirements. The client wanted a user-friendly, responsive website that allowed customers to view available vehicles, make bookings, and manage their reservations online.

Key Requirements

  1. Responsive Design: The website needed to be accessible across various devices, ensuring a seamless user experience on desktops, tablets, and smartphones.
  2. Booking System: A robust booking system allowing users to check vehicle availability, make reservations, and receive confirmations.
  3. Admin Panel: An easy-to-use admin panel for the client to manage vehicles, bookings, and customer data.
  4. SEO Optimization: Ensuring the website is optimized for search engines to increase visibility and attract more customers.

Design and Architecture

Wireframing and Prototyping

The design phase commenced with wireframing to layout the website’s structure and user flow. This process was followed by prototyping, where we developed interactive models of the website to visualize the user experience.

User Interface (UI) and User Experience (UX) Design

Our design team focused on creating an intuitive and aesthetically pleasing interface. Key elements included:

  • Navigation: Simplified menu and search functionality to help users find information quickly.
  • Visuals: High-quality images of vehicles and a clean, modern design to engage visitors.
  • Accessibility: Ensuring the website is accessible to users with disabilities, adhering to WCAG guidelines.

Development Phases

Front-End Development

Utilizing HTML5, CSS3, and JavaScript, our developers created a responsive front-end. We implemented frameworks like Bootstrap to streamline the development process and ensure consistency across different screen sizes.

Back-End Development

The back-end was developed using PHP and MySQL, providing a robust and scalable solution for managing bookings and customer data. Key components included:

  • Booking System: Integration with a real-time availability checker and a secure payment gateway.
  • Admin Panel: Custom-built using PHP, allowing the client to update vehicle listings, manage bookings, and generate reports.
  • Database Management: Efficient data storage and retrieval systems to ensure quick access to information and smooth operation.

Testing Procedures

Functional Testing

We conducted extensive functional testing to ensure all features worked as intended. This included:

  • Booking System: Testing the booking flow from vehicle selection to payment and confirmation.
  • Admin Panel: Ensuring all management functionalities were accessible and user-friendly.

Performance Testing

To guarantee optimal performance, we carried out load testing to simulate multiple users accessing the website simultaneously. This helped in identifying and addressing any performance bottlenecks.

Security Testing

Security was a paramount concern. We performed vulnerability assessments to safeguard against SQL injections, cross-site scripting (XSS), and other potential threats.

Deployment Strategies

The deployment phase involved migrating the website from the development environment to the live server. Key steps included:

  • Server Setup: Configuring the hosting environment to ensure compatibility with the website’s requirements.
  • Data Migration: Transferring all necessary data, including vehicle listings and customer information, to the live server.
  • DNS Configuration: Updating domain settings to point to the new website.

Post-Launch Maintenance and Support

Post-launch, we provided continuous support to ensure the website’s smooth operation. Our services included:

  • Regular Updates: Implementing security patches and software updates to keep the website secure and up-to-date.
  • Performance Monitoring: Using tools to monitor website performance and address any issues promptly.
  • Customer Support: Offering technical support to the client for any queries or issues encountered.

SEO Strategies and Business Growth

SEO Optimization

To boost the website’s visibility and attract more traffic, we implemented a comprehensive SEO strategy. Key tactics included:

  • Keyword Research: Identifying relevant keywords for the car hire industry and incorporating them into the website’s content.
  • On-Page SEO: Optimizing meta titles, descriptions, headers, and images to improve search engine rankings.
  • Content Marketing: Creating high-quality content, such as blog posts and articles, to engage users and improve SEO.

Outcomes and Impact

The SEO efforts resulted in significant improvements in search engine rankings, leading to increased website traffic and higher booking rates. Key metrics included:

  • Traffic Increase: A 40% increase in organic traffic within the first three months post-launch.
  • Improved Rankings: Achieved top positions for targeted keywords related to car hire in London.
  • User Engagement: Increased average session duration and lower bounce rates, indicating better user engagement.

Challenges and Solutions

Development Challenges

One of the primary challenges was integrating a real-time booking system with the client’s existing vehicle management system. Our solution involved creating a custom API to facilitate seamless data exchange between the two systems.

Design Challenges

Ensuring a consistent user experience across different devices required rigorous testing and optimization. We addressed this by using a mobile-first approach in our design process and leveraging responsive design frameworks.

Team Collaboration and Project Management

Agile Methodology

We employed Agile methodologies to manage the project efficiently. This involved regular sprints, daily stand-ups, and continuous feedback loops to ensure the project stayed on track and met all client requirements.

Team Efforts

The success of the project was a result of collaborative efforts from various teams, including:

  • Design Team: Focused on creating an intuitive and engaging user interface.
  • Development Team: Handled the technical aspects, from front-end development to back-end integration.
  • SEO Team: Ensured the website was optimized for search engines to drive traffic and business growth.

Lessons Learned

The Wise Cars project provided valuable insights into managing complex web development projects. Key lessons included:

  • Importance of Clear Communication: Regular communication with the client and within the team was crucial for addressing issues promptly and ensuring everyone was aligned with project goals.
  • Flexibility in Approach: Adapting to changes and being flexible in our approach helped in overcoming unexpected challenges effectively.
  • Continuous Improvement: Regularly reviewing and refining our processes led to more efficient project management and better outcomes.

Conclusion

The development of the Wise Cars website is a testament to V1 Technologies' expertise in delivering cutting-edge web solutions. By leveraging our technical skills, design proficiency, and SEO strategies, we created a user-friendly and highly functional car hire portal that has significantly enhanced the client’s business operations and growth. This case study highlights our commitment to excellence and our ability to tackle complex projects, making us a reliable partner for businesses seeking innovative web solutions.